Description

The calibration technician is responsible for maintaining, testing and calibrating the variety of instruments and equipment; Ensures that all instruments, meters and test devices are calibrated correctly and perform accurate readings. Comply with the Policy and Quality Manual (QM), Description of the System of Calibration (CSD) of MPC and the internal work regulations.


Responsible for calibrating variety of test instruments for one or more skill areas, such as:

  • Electrical Equipment
  • Dimensional Equipment
  • Industrial / Mechanical Equipment
  • Temperature Equipment
  • RF/Optical Equipment
  • Mechanical
